Presentation of the Nemiga Princess Casino, Minsk
Nemiga Princess Casino, located in the vibrant commercial district of Nemiga, offers a refined gaming experience in the heart of Minsk, the capital of Belarus. Spanning two floors and covering 1,000 square meters, the casino combines comfort and privacy with a wide variety of gaming options in a welcoming atmosphere.
The casino features an impressive selection of slot machines and classic table games, catering to both casual players and seasoned gamblers. Whether you enjoy spinning the reels or playing strategic card games, this venue provides entertainment for all preferences.
Upon request, an exclusive private gaming area is available for guests who value discretion. This service allows high-stakes players and VIP guests to enjoy their favorite games in a more intimate setting.
Although specific details regarding the number of gaming machines and tables are not publicly disclosed, Nemiga Princess Casino is renowned for its clean layout, professional service, and convenient central location.
Open daily, Nemiga Princess Casino is an excellent choice for those looking to unwind with games of chance after exploring the lively city center of Minsk. Please note that guests must be 21 or older, and valid photo identification is required for entry.

The City
Minsk is the capital and largest city of the Republic of Belarus. Home to nearly 2 million residents, it serves as the country’s political, economic, and cultural heart.
Located along the Svislach River, Minsk features wide boulevards, Soviet-era architecture, and a growing modern skyline. It serves as the central hub for tourism in Belarus, with most of the country’s major landmarks and institutions situated within the city.
At the heart of the city lies Victory Square, a symbolic site surrounded by monuments and public spaces. Nearby, the Church of Saints Simon and Helena, also known as the Red Church, is one of Minsk’s most iconic and photographed landmarks.
The National Library of Belarus, a futuristic, diamond-shaped structure, stands out as one of the country’s most architecturally impressive and innovative buildings.
For those in search of green spaces, Victory Park and the Botanical Garden of the National Academy of Sciences provide peaceful retreats filled with natural beauty and walking paths.
